House Leveling in Mooresville, NC
House leveling services involve adjusting and stabilizing a building’s foundation to correct uneven or sagging floors, cracks, and other structural issues. These projects typically address homes that have settled over time, experienced shifting due to soil movement, or show signs of foundation damage. Property owners often seek house leveling to improve safety, prevent further structural deterioration, and restore the home’s overall stability and appearance.

House Leveling Questions
What causes a house to need leveling services? Shifting soil, poor drainage, and foundation settling can lead to uneven floors and structural issues requiring leveling.
How can I tell if my house needs to be leveled? Signs include cracked walls, uneven flooring, and gaps around doors or windows.
What types of projects typically require house leveling? Residential homes with foundation settlement, slab leveling, or uneven basement floors often need this service.
